The Faroese separatist movement is less than 100 years old. They voted for independence in 1946, but the referendum was not recognized by the king. They got autonomy instead and today function as an independent country with a few asterisks. They will probably become independent within 20-50 years. >Corsica
Probably the most serious in mainland France. They used to do some terrorist attack but only 8 people died between 1972 and 1999, including 4 drug dealers. Their independantist parties are usually left wing, but anti-immigration and pretty racist. A lot of far-right people in the island are also independantist.
It's probable that they get some autonomy one day, but not independance tb.h
>Basque Country
We only have a small part of basque country so we don't really heard about them. Probably left wing like their spaniards counterparts.
>Alsace
Used to do some bombing (without victims) in the 70's, now independantist are just some far-right guys who used to be neo-nazis. Autonomist parties can be pretty strong tho', but they're more center-right.
>Brittany
Bunch of marxists guys who don't want to be part of fascist France anymore. Also a few meme far-right parties. Most of britons don't really want independance, or only joke about it. A lot would probably want some autonomy but nothing serious.
>Savoy
A few far-right guys, nothing serious. Most regionalist parties just want to defend savoy culture, and nobody really think about independance.
>Nice
Same as above, a few far-right guys who claim they want independance, but Nicois are usually very patriotic about France.
>Catalunia
Don't really heard about them, I guess independantist are mostly in Spanish Catalunia
>Occitania
Just a meme, most regionalist parties are just associations who want to promote occitan culture. Only a bunch of far-left parties want independance but they're irrelevant
>Franche Comté
A few irrelevant far-right guys
>Normandy
No one want independance here
damn just fuck my shit up in spain.
Overseas:
>Guyane
Their far-left decolonialist independant party usually did something like 5% at elections. However a less extreme canditate who've got links with independantist parties did 30%
>Martinique
A coalition of left wing parties who include some independantist party did 54% at the last elections. The independantist party only had 5 seats on 51.
>Guadeloupe
Their independantist party did 0,50% at the last elections
>Reunion island
A small far-left party but irrelevant, don't even put a candidate at elections. Reunionese are usually the less problematic of our overseas populations.
>Mayotte
They often have a referendum on independance, each time they chose to stay french, with a large majority. That make Comoros butthurt tb.h
>New Caledonia
Hard situation, their far left independantist parties usually get 30-40% at elections, almost every kanaks vote for them.
Caldoche (kind of caledonians pied noirs), immigrants from pacific and asians vote for loyalists parties.
A referendum on independance is planned on 2018. Also a mini civil war happened in the 80's.
>French Polynesia
Their independantist party is a coalition between some far-left, left and center-right parties, they did 29% at the last elections. They're not violent, not like kanaks.
